WebEnterprise-focused marketing analytics and digital economy professional currently leading over £10 million worth of projects across the continuing … Web2 de mar. de 2024 · How are professional sports funded? › The funding of sports performers Potential sources are: Wages - Some sports pay performers a salary for playing. Appearance money - In some sports, players can be paid for taking part, usually by the event's sponsors. Prize money - The winner of an event may receive a sum of money.

Web13 de dez. de 2024 · LeRoy, of Good Jobs First, said spending upwards of $1 billion on a new NFL stadium will result in more revenue for the league and team, and an increase of the franchise value for the Pegulas. The Pegula’s bought the Bills in 2014 for $1.4 billion and Forbes magazine estimated in August that the team is now worth $2.27 billion. WebUK Sport is funded by a mix of Government Exchequer and National Lottery income. Who does UK Sport report to? UK Sport is accountable to the Department for Culture, Media and Sport. UK Sport has a very clear remit at the ‘top end’ of Britain’s sporting pathway, with no direct involvement in community or school sport.
